If a player wants to explore a transfer, he will provide written notification to his universitys designated administrator. That administrator will then gather the players pertinent information (email address, phone number, etc.) and enter it into the portal website. Permissible: They may say, We have a need for a transfer middle, and have scholarship money available, but we cannot speak to or about specific athletes unless they are on the transfer portal. The database also stores basic information, such as contact details, scholarship status and whether the player is transferring as a graduate student. A coach can sort by most recent players to enter the portal and save names to a "Transfer Watch List." If they enter the portal on the last day of the fall term, they may be removed from scholarship starting in the spring term. The transfer portal database stores the names of student-athletes across all college sports who have entered, sortable by sport and player name. In technical terms, the portal is a website that acts as a centralized database for players who are interested in transferring.
